On Friday 29th to Saturday 30th May 2026, the Parliamentary Green Investment Dialogue and National Capacity Building was hosted, with the aim of reinforcing Seychelles’ leadership as a Small Island Developing State (SIDS) pursuing innovative, resilient, and investment-oriented climate solutions. The event was held under the Parliamentarians for Climate Finance Project (PCF), which is being implemented by the Climate Parliament and the United Nations Industrial Development Organisation (UNIDO) with support from the Green Climate Fund (GCF).
Parliamentarians, experts, and stakeholders convened to advance Seychelles’ green transition, discussing renewable energy, climate finance, sustainable infrastructure, and policy development while exploring solutions to financing and implementation challenges, and emphasizing the crucial role of strong legislation and collaboration in building a climate-resilient future.
